首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

打印For循环中的变量[重复]

基础概念

在编程中,for循环是一种控制结构,用于重复执行一段代码,直到满足特定条件。for循环通常包括初始化、条件检查和迭代三个部分。

相关优势

  1. 简洁性for循环提供了一种简洁的方式来表达重复操作。
  2. 灵活性:可以轻松控制循环的次数和每次循环的行为。
  3. 可读性for循环的结构清晰,易于理解和维护。

类型

for循环有多种类型,包括:

  1. 计数器循环:最常见的for循环类型,用于按顺序执行一定次数的操作。
  2. 条件循环:基于某个条件来决定是否继续循环。
  3. 迭代器循环:使用迭代器遍历集合或数组。

应用场景

for循环广泛应用于各种场景,例如:

  • 遍历数组或列表中的元素。
  • 执行固定次数的操作。
  • 处理文件中的每一行数据。
  • 进行批量数据处理等。

问题描述

for循环中打印变量时,可能会遇到变量值重复的问题。这通常是由于循环变量的作用域问题或逻辑错误导致的。

原因分析

  1. 作用域问题:如果在循环外部定义了变量,并在循环内部修改它,可能会导致意外的结果。
  2. 逻辑错误:循环内部的逻辑可能不正确,导致变量值没有按预期变化。

解决方法

以下是一个示例代码,展示如何在for循环中正确打印变量:

代码语言:txt
复制
# 示例代码:打印for循环中的变量
for i in range(5):
    print(f"当前循环次数: {i}")

在这个示例中,i是循环变量,每次循环都会更新其值,并打印出来。

参考链接

如果你遇到具体的问题或错误,请提供更多的上下文信息,以便更准确地诊断和解决问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券